What is Instagram Reels

Instagram Reels is their latest video feature that allows users to shoot a video of up to 15 seconds of music on Instagram.

This latest video feature is available in 50 countries including India, UK, Australia and US. In the coming months, Instagram will release this feature worldwide.

This concept is similar to Tik Tok.It has a separate video feed where you can watch videos from all accounts even though that you don’t follow.

To create a reel,go to the top right corner and tap the camera button or go to create a story and sweep over to reels.

Left hand side it has handy editing tools to edit your videos.

Select ‘Audio’ and add music.

Adjust the Speed by pressing play icon

Choose the Effects to add filters.

Set the Timer,there will be a count before the recording starts.

Press the record button and capture your videos. It has similar features like Tiktok. you can push and play the recordings multiple times.

After finishing recording,try to add eye catching video thumbnails from your video or your camera roll.Make sure add captions and hashtags to get better engagement.

Now tap the share button to post your reels on stories and explore feed.after posting reels there will open a new reel tab on your instagram profile.

Note-If you have a private Instagram account, only people who currently follow you can see your reel.

Reels Sizes You Need to Know

Thumbnail — 1:1 Square or 1080 x 1080

This is used for your thumbnail previews on your profile

Portrait — 4:5 Rectangle or 1080 x 1350

This is when people scroll through their Instagram Feed, it will display in 4:5

Full Screen – 9:16 or 1080 x 1920 (Recommended

This size is what you record your Reels in and how it shows up under the Reels tab on your profile.
